ECB shrugs off Fed concern on dollar

By Ralph Atkins in Frankfurt

Published: June 9 2008 20:06 | Last updated: June 9 2008 23:23

The fight against inflation in the 15-country eurozone will remain the European Central Bank’s top priority even if that clashes with US attempts to prevent a further slide in the dollar, a senior official at the bank made clear on Monday.

The ECB’s actions and words “aim at ensuring the preservation of price stability”, said Lucas Papademos, the bank’s vice-president.
